Johnson exits Big Lots
By Furniture Today Staff -- Furniture Today, January 23, 2005
Columbus, Ohio — John Johnson, who was senior vice president, general merchandise manager for home at Big Lots, has left the company.
Johnson, who was responsible for furniture, home textiles, apparel and toys, will not be replaced. Vice presidents and divisional merchandise managers for each business will instead report to John Martin, executive vice president, merchandising.
Bob Segal covers furniture, and Crystal Weary handles home textiles.
